岗位职责:
1、从事基于Linux c++技术产品的系统原理设计、应用开发工作;
2、负责应用软件的功能设计、开发、测试、交付及维护;
3、及时配合完成设备的软件说明书和其他竣工文件编制并整理归档;
4、负责产品关键零组件评估选型、系统原理图及PCB绘制,指标设计验证、功能参数验证、接口规范验证、整机性能验证;
5、负责产品成本性能分析及成本优化改善;
6、参与产品可量产性评估优化及导入工作﹐配合批量生产。
岗位要求:
1、精通C/C++,熟悉STL模板库,boost库等开源库及常见的设计模式;熟悉arm架构,熟悉Linux,可以做基于linux 的C++应用开发
2、具备良好的数据结构及算法的设计和实现能力,能够高效、高质量完成程序的设计、开发与测试;
3、熟练掌握调试、多线程、网络、文件访问等开发技术;
4、熟悉各类数据库(Oracle,MsSql,MySql,sqlite)业务流程开发;
5、有一定硬件产品研发经验,精通数字电路设计、电力电子技术,熟练使用嘉立创等设计软件;
6、熟悉ARM、DSP等CPU,熟悉USB/SPI/I2C等硬件接口;
7、本科及以上学历,计算机相关专业;
8、动手能力强,有良好的人际沟通能力和团队合作精神、主动、责任心强。有独立完成项目经验者优先。